HamburgerMenu
hirist

Job Description

WLAN QA Automation Test Engineer


Experience : 2.5 - 10 Years


Designation : Engineer (SW) / Manager (SW)


Location : Chennai


Job Description :


We are seeking a highly motivated and skilled WLAN QA Automation Test Engineer to join our dynamic team in Chennai. The ideal candidate will have a strong background in software quality assurance with a focus on automation, particularly within Wireless Local Area Network (WLAN) technologies. You will be responsible for designing, developing, and executing automated test suites to ensure the quality and reliability of our cutting-edge WLAN products.


Responsibilities :


- Design, develop, and maintain robust and scalable automated test frameworks and test scripts for WLAN products using Python.


- Utilize and extend existing automation frameworks such as Pytest, PyATS, or Robot Framework.


- Develop and implement API automation tests, leveraging strong knowledge of the Flask framework.


- Collaborate with development and QA teams to identify test requirements, create test plans, and ensure comprehensive test coverage.


- Execute automated test suites, analyze results, identify defects, and report findings to the development team.


- Work extensively with L2/L3 networking protocols and wireless standards (e.g., 802.11a/b/g/n/ac/ax) to design relevant test scenarios.


- Integrate automated tests into the CI/CD pipeline to enable continuous testing and delivery.


- Participate in code reviews and contribute to the overall quality of the automation codebase.


- Troubleshoot and debug complex issues in WLAN environments.


- Stay up-to-date with the latest industry trends and technologies in WLAN and test automation.


- Mentor junior engineers and contribute to the growth of the team (for Manager SW level).


Required Skills and Qualifications :


- Experience : 2.5 to 10 years of experience in QA automation, specifically within WLAN or networking domains.


- Programming Expertise : Proven experience as a Python Developer, with a strong understanding of object-oriented programming (OOP) principles and best practices.


- Test Automation Frameworks : Expertise in developing test automation using one or more of the following frameworks : Pytest, PyATS, Robot Framework.


- API Automation : Strong knowledge and hands-on experience with the Flask framework for developing and automating RESTful APIs.


- Networking Protocols : Strong experience and in-depth knowledge of L2/L3 Networking protocols (e.g., TCP/IP, UDP, ARP, VLANs, Routing) and various Wireless protocols (e.g., 802.11 standards, WPA/WPA2/WPA3).


- Version Control : Proficient in using version control systems, especially Git, for code management and collaboration.


- Problem-Solving : Excellent analytical and problem-solving skills with a keen eye for detail.


- Communication : Strong verbal and written communication skills to effectively collaborate with cross-functional teams.


- Team Player : Ability to work independently as well as a part of a collaborative team.


Desired Skills (Plus Points) :


- Experience with network emulators or simulators.


- Familiarity with network monitoring tools (e.g., Wireshark).


- Understanding of virtualization technologies (e.g., Docker, Kubernetes).


- Experience with performance testing and security testing for WLAN systems.

info-icon

Did you find something suspicious?